Understanding Jillian Michaels Ethnicity
Jillian Michaels ethnicity is typically described as mixed European ancestry. Public records and interviews indicate she has roots in German, Irish, and English backgrounds, reflecting a blend of cultural influences that many people in the United States share.
It is important to note that she has not provided exhaustive genealogical details in mainstream interviews, so descriptions of her ethnicity are based on what she has shared publicly and what can be reasonably inferred from available information.
